Factors to Consider When Choosing a Psychiatrist in Peachtree Corners
Finding psychiatrists in Peachtree Corners starts with understanding the type of care you want to search for. Psychiatrists and psychiatric mental health nurse practitioners can diagnose mental health conditions, prescribe medication, and manage ongoing medication plans. Therapists provide talk therapy and may work with you on concerns like anxiety, depression, ADHD, OCD, or stress. Some people start with a therapist, some start with a prescriber, and some work with both. As you compare options, look for a psychiatrist whose listed specialties, clinical focus, and experience match what you want support with.
Peachtree Corners is a smaller local market, so nearby options may include psychiatrists in Norcross, Dunwoody, and other parts of the Atlanta metro area. Virtual appointments can also expand your search while keeping care accessible from home. Psychiatry visits, especially medication management appointments, are often shorter and less frequent than therapy sessions. Some psychiatrists also offer therapy, depending on their practice. Before booking, review each psychiatrist’s bio for availability, appointment format, areas of focus, and communication style so you can decide who fits your schedule and preferences.

If you're already taking psychiatric medication and considering switching providers, talk to your current prescriber before changing or stopping any medication — most psychiatric medications shouldn't be stopped abruptly. Anyone experiencing thoughts of self-harm or in acute crisis should call 988 or go to the nearest emergency department rather than wait for an outpatient appointment.
